Amazon account suspension is a nightmare that any seller might go through because of several reasons. Amazon account suspension refers to the temporary or permanent restriction of an Amazon seller account on the Amazon platform. When you get to see an Amazon account suspended, you lose access to most selling privileges, including the ability to sell products, make new product listings or withdraw funds from your account.

High order defect rate
An order defect occurs when there are issues with the fulfillment process, such as canceled orders, late shipments, or orders that result in negative customer experiences (such as receiving damaged or incorrect items). If a seller has a high order defect rate, meaning a significant portion of their orders results in defects, it reflects poorly on their performance. Amazon monitors these metrics closely, and if the order defect rate exceeds acceptable thresholds, it can lead to account suspension.
Late shipments
Timely delivery is crucial to customer satisfaction. If a seller consistently fails to ship orders within the expected time frames, it can result in dissatisfied customers and a negative impact on their experience. Amazon expects sellers to meet the designated shipping deadlines, and repeated instances of late shipments can lead to Amazon Account suspension.

Account hacking or unauthorized access
If an account shows signs of unauthorized access, suspicious activity, or potential security breaches, Amazon may suspend the account to protect the user’s information.
Let’s throw some light on the reasons that can lead to Amazon Account suspension due to account hacking or unauthorized access:
Unauthorized access
If there are signs indicating that an Amazon seller account has been accessed by unauthorized individuals without the account owner’s knowledge or consent, Amazon takes immediate action to protect the user’s information. Unauthorized access can occur due to various reasons, such as weak passwords, phishing attempts, or security vulnerabilities.
Suspicious activity
Amazon employs sophisticated systems to monitor account activity and identify suspicious behavior. If an account exhibits unusual or suspicious activity, such as a sudden surge in order volume, changes to account settings without authorization, or abnormal login patterns, it may indicate a security breach or potential compromise. To mitigate any risks to the account owner’s data and prevent further unauthorized actions, you may get your Amazon account temporarily suspended.
Potential security breaches
If Amazon’s systems or external sources indicate a potential security breach that could compromise user information or the overall integrity of the platform, Amazon takes proactive measures to protect its users. This can include suspending accounts that may have been affected until a thorough investigation is conducted to determine the extent of the breach and implement appropriate security measures.
Amazon Account suspension in cases of account hacking or unauthorized access is primarily a protective measure employed by Amazon. By this type of Amazon Account Suspension, Amazon aims to prevent unauthorized individuals from conducting fraudulent activities, accessing sensitive information, or causing harm to the account owner or other users.
During this Account Suspension period, Amazon typically investigates the incident to identify the root cause, assess the impact, and implement necessary security measures to prevent future breaches. The account owner may be notified about the suspension and provided with instructions on how to secure their account, change passwords, or take other necessary steps to regain access.
To minimize the risk of account hacking or unauthorized access, sellers should prioritize the security of their Amazon accounts. This includes using strong, unique passwords, enabling two-factor authentication, regularly monitoring account activity, and promptly reporting any suspicious incidents or unauthorized access to Amazon.
